Canary Island, Vic, 3537 Area Guide

Overview:


Canary Island is a small rural locality located in the state of Victoria, Australia. It is situated in the Loddon Shire and is approximately 220 kilometers northwest of Melbourne, the capital city of Victoria. The area is known for its peaceful and scenic surroundings, making it an ideal place for those seeking a tranquil lifestyle away from the hustle and bustle of the city.

Transport & Access:


Canary Island is primarily accessed by road. The nearest major town is Kerang, which is about 20 kilometers away. From Kerang, residents and visitors can travel to Canary Island via the Loddon Valley Highway. Public transportation options are limited in the area, so owning a private vehicle is essential for convenient travel.
